Mastering the Balance: An In-Depth Look at the Benefits of Hybrid Cloud Computing

Cloud computing has revolutionized the way organizations handle their IT infrastructure, offering unparalleled flexibility, scalability, and cost savings. However, the traditional approach of relying solely on either public or private clouds may not provide the optimal solution for every organization’s needs. Enter hybrid cloud computing, a new approach that combines the benefits of both public and private clouds to maximize flexibility and control over cloud infrastructure.

Security and cost savings in hybrid cloud computing

Security is a paramount concern for organizations, especially when dealing with sensitive data and applications. With hybrid cloud computing, organizations can keep their most critical and sensitive data on a private cloud, benefiting from added security measures and exclusive control. This ensures that only authorized individuals have access to the sensitive data, reducing the risk of data breaches or unauthorized exposure. Simultaneously, organizations can take advantage of the cost savings offered by public clouds by storing less sensitive data and applications on these platforms. This two-tiered approach strikes a balance between security and cost, delivering the best of both worlds.

Workload placement flexibility in hybrid cloud computing

One of the key advantages of hybrid cloud computing is the freedom to choose where to run workloads. This flexibility allows organizations to optimize their cloud infrastructure based on specific needs, such as performance requirements, data sovereignty regulations, or compliance concerns. By strategically placing workloads on either public or private clouds, organizations can ensure optimal performance, data control, and regulatory compliance. This intelligent workload placement helps organizations achieve their objectives efficiently while maximizing the value derived from their cloud investments.

Resilience and disaster recovery capabilities in hybrid cloud computing

Ensuring business continuity and minimizing downtime are crucial for organizations. Hybrid cloud computing provides greater resilience through redundancy across both public and private clouds. In the event of a cloud outage or disaster, the redundant infrastructure ensures that services remain available and uninterrupted. This redundancy minimizes the impact of unforeseen circumstances and enhances disaster recovery capabilities. Organizations can rest assured knowing that their critical operations are safeguarded, reducing potential financial losses and maintaining customer satisfaction.
